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PULL 07/10] mirror: limit niov to IOV_MAX elements, again

From: John Snow <jsnow@redhat.com>
During the refactor of mirror_iteration in e5b43573,
we regressed the fix introduced in cae98cb8.
This patch re-adds IOV_MAX checking to cases where we
aren't checking alignment (and size) already.

diff --git a/block/mirror.c b/block/mirror.c
index 42ebc3b..5bac906 100644
--- a/block/mirror.c
+++ b/block/mirror.c
@@ -231,11 +231,14 @@ static int mirror_do_read(MirrorBlockJob *s, int64_t sector_num,
int sectors_per_chunk, nb_chunks;
int ret;
MirrorOp *op;
+ int max_sectors;
sectors_per_chunk = s->granularity >> BDRV_SECTOR_BITS;
+ max_sectors = sectors_per_chunk * s->max_iov;
/* We can only handle as much as buf_size at a time. */
nb_sectors = MIN(s->buf_size >> BDRV_SECTOR_BITS, nb_sectors);
+ nb_sectors = MIN(max_sectors, nb_sectors);
assert(nb_sectors);
ret = nb_sectors;
